#fe593b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fe593b is composed of 99.6% red, 34.9%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65% magenta, 76.8%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 9.2 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 61.4%. #fe593b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b276 with #fd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#fe593b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fe593b has RGB values of R:254, G:89, B:59 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.77, K:0. Its decimal value is 16668987.
